The Itinerary: Sights, Hidden Gems, and Green Spaces
The tour visits Dublin’s main attractions like The Guinness Storehouse, Trinity College with the Book of Kells, Dublin Castle, and the Jameson Whiskey Distillery. Entrance tickets aren’t included but can be booked in advance, allowing you to skip lines and avoid disappointment. Your guide may also recommend some lesser-known attractions, giving you a more authentic feel of the city beyond the usual tourist spots.
One of the highlights is a visit to Phoenix Park, the largest enclosed city park in Europe. Here, you’ll enjoy a relaxing break with local snacks and coffee, and the chance to see the herd of Fallow Deer roaming freely. Guides often point out the park’s importance as a green oasis in the city, perfect for picnics or a quiet walk.

FAQ
Is hotel pickup included? Yes, the tour includes hotel pickup from Dublin.
What is the group size? The tour is designed for groups of up to 7 people, ensuring an intimate experience.
What is the duration of the tour? The tour lasts approximately 8 hours, including sightseeing and breaks.
Are entrance tickets to attractions included? No, entrance tickets are not included but can be booked separately in advance.
Is lunch included? No, lunch is not included, but there is time allocated for a break and local snacks are provided.
Can the itinerary be customized? Yes, the guide can tailor the route to your interests, whether focusing on history, culture, or hidden gems.
What amenities are in the vehicle? The vehicle offers air conditioning, USB ports, and commentary speakers for a comfortable experience.
Are children welcome? Yes, children’s safety car seats are available, making it suitable for families.
Do I need to book in advance? It’s recommended to reserve ahead, especially if you want to visit specific attractions, as tickets must be booked in advance.
Is the tour suitable for first-time visitors? Absolutely. It’s designed to give a comprehensive, hassle-free introduction to Dublin’s highlights and lesser-known spots.
